A pet store owner, Byron, needs to determine how much food he needs to feed the animals. Byron knows that he needs to order the

same amount of bird food as hamster food. He needs four times as much dog food as bird food and needs half the amount of cat food as dog food. If Byron orders 600 packages of animal food, how much dog food does he buy? Let b represent the number of packages of bird food Byron purchased for the pet store.
(Hint: Create a table or an equation to help answer the question. There ARE two steps that need to be taken before arriving at your answer.
A.250
B.300
C.275
D.315

Number of dog food packages bought by Byron is 300

Step-by-step explanation:

  • Step 1: Given number of bird food packages = b. Find the number of packages for the other animal foods.

Number of hamster food packages = b.

Number of dog food packages = 4b

Number of cat food packages = 1/2 of 4b = 2b

Total food packages = 600

⇒ b + b + 4b + 2b = 600

⇒ 8b = 600

⇒ b = 600/8 = 75

  • Step 2: Calculate the amount of dog food

∴ 4b = 4 × 75 = 300

An animal shelter needs to find homes for 40 dogs and 60 cats. If 15% of the dogs are female, and 25% of the cats are female, wh
Harrizon [31]

Answer:

21% of the animals are female

Step-by-step explanation:

In total:

There are 40 + 60 = 100 animals.

Female animals.

40 dogs. Of those, 15% are female. So 0.15*40 = 6.

60 cats. Of those, 25% are female. So 0.25*60 = 15.

21 female animals.

21/100 = 0.21 = 21%

21% of the animals are female
